The Russia Convergent Billing Market is witnessing steady growth driven by the increasing adoption of digital services and the proliferation of connected devices. Convergent billing solutions are in demand as they enable service providers to consolidate and streamline billing processes across multiple services such as telecom, internet, and content delivery. This market is also influenced by the rising demand for personalized and bundled services, driving the need for flexible and scalable billing systems. Key players in the Russia Convergent Billing Market include Amdocs, CSG International, and Oracle, who offer innovative billing solutions to cater to the evolving needs of telecom operators and digital service providers in the region. The Russian government has implemented several policies to regulate the Convergent Billing market. The Federal Antimonopoly Service (FAS) has been actively monitoring the market to ensure fair competition and prevent monopolistic practices. Additionally, the government has introduced legislation aimed at protecting consumer rights in relation to billing services, including requirements for transparent pricing and billing practices. Furthermore, there are regulations in place to promote the development of digital infrastructure and encourage innovation in the telecommunications sector, which has a direct impact on the Convergent Billing market. Overall, the government`s policies are geared towards fostering a competitive and consumer-friendly environment in the Russian Convergent Billing market.
